Output 8709bc814df03077026771f9fc590ad9f14e802efd821148770a890f8aab1a27:3

value
356919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 187c7b966a61819c8f9347318cd7edde518a141c OP_EQUAL
address
33vVGMwBf4phWCNYbVjpfDVMxmfuAmz7qL
transaction
8709bc814df03077026771f9fc590ad9f14e802efd821148770a890f8aab1a27
spent
true